[15a-A404-10] The Band Structure Evaluation of MoS2(1-x)Te2x

Yusuke Hibino1,2, Kota Yamazaki1, Yusuke Hashimoto1, Yuya Oyanagi1, Naomi Sawamoto1, Hideaki Machida3, Masato Ishikawa3, Hiroshi Sudoh3, Hitoshi Wakabayashi4, Atsushi Ogura1 (1.Meiji Univ., 2.JSPS Research Fellow, 3.Gas Phase Growth Ltd., 4.Tokyo Tech.)

Keywords:Layered material, Alloy, Band structure

In this study, the band structure evaluation MoS2(1-x)Te2x, the alloy of MoS2 and MoTe2, is reported. MoS2 and MoTe2 were co-sputtered in order to obtain the precursor for the following thermal treatment in Te or S ambient with organic precursor. Spectroscopic ellipsometry, X-ray photoelectron spectroscopy and X-ray diffraction evaluations were carried out to obtain the bandgap, the valence band edge positions, and the physical strucuture, respectively. From these results, it was revealed that the band structure shifts according to the Te concentration.
